A traffic collision on US Highway 101 North in Mill Valley, CA, caused significant traffic disruptions today during the morning commute. The incident involved two vehicles, including a driveable Toyota RAV4 and a second vehicle that was not driveable.
The collision occurred around 9:19 AM when debris, including a sofa, obstructed the roadway, prompting vehicles to swerve to avoid it. One vehicle was rear-ended while stopped due to the obstruction, leading to a complete halt of traffic in the area. California Highway Patrol units quickly arrived on the scene to manage the situation and ensure safety.
As a result of the traffic incident, multiple lanes were closed, creating backups for motorists. A tow truck was called to assist with the removal of the vehicles involved. By approximately 9:32 AM, the roadway was cleared, but delays persisted as traffic began to resume.
